面向对象和面向过程编程

作者&投稿:剧元 (若有异议请与网页底部的电邮联系)

c++面向对象和面向过程有什么不一样?
面向对象编程(OOP)和面向过程编程是两种不同的编程范式,它们有着一些明显的区别。我们常说的面向对象和面向过程一般是指编程时的抽象逻辑,编程语言典型示例如;面向对象C++,面向过程c语言。1.1 思维方式不同:面向对象编程强调的是将数据和操作数据的方法组合在一起,以对象的形式呈现,通过对象之间的...

怎么通俗理解面向对象和面向过程
怎么通俗理解面向对象和面向过程?相关内容如下:一、面向过程编程:面向过程编程是一种以过程为中心的编程范式。在这种范式下,程序被看作一系列顺序执行的步骤,每一步骤都是一个独立的函数或过程。程序的主要控制逻辑是由程序员定义的函数和过程所组成的。面向过程编程更加注重步骤和流程,强调程序的执行...

面向过程和面向对象的区别和联系
面向过程和面向对象是编程中的两种主要编程范式,它们有着明显的区别和联系。面向过程是一种关注实现功能的流程和方法的方式,注重执行的过程。而面向对象则是一种基于对象的方法,将数据和操作封装在一起,形成一个整体。两者的区别在于关注点不同,而联系在于都是为了实现特定的功能或目标。解释:面向过程...

面向过程与面向对象编程的区别和优缺点
1. 面向过程编程的优点在于其性能较高,因为这种方法直接执行函数,而不需要创建对象实例,因此减少了资源消耗和开销。这在资源受限的环境中(如单片机、嵌入式系统、Linux\/Unix平台)尤为重要,因为性能是关键考量因素。2. 面向过程编程的缺点在于它缺乏面向对象的维护性、可复用性和可扩展性。由于过程式...

什么是面向过程和面向对象的编程?
面向过程:优点:性能比面向对象高,适合跟硬件联系很紧密的东西,例如单片机就采用的面向过程编程。缺点:没有面向对象易维护、易复用、易扩展 面向对象:优点:易维护、易复用、易扩展,由于面向对象有封装、继承、多态性的特性,可以设计出低耦合的系统,使系统更加灵活、更加易于维护 缺点:性能比面向过程...

面向对象和面向过程的区别理解
1、面向对象(Object-Oriented)和面向过程(Procedure-Oriented)是两种不同的编程范式和思维方式。2、面向过程编程是一种基于步骤和过程的编程方式。它将程序视为一系列的步骤或函数,通过依次执行这些步骤来解决问题。在面向过程编程中,数据和逻辑被分离,关注的是程序的流程控制。3、面向对象编程则以对象...

面向对象和面向过程有什么不同?麻烦请形象一点说明...
面向对象和面向过程的主要区别在于编程的思维方式。面向对象更关注现实世界中的事物和事物之间的关系,而面向过程则更注重步骤和流程。下面是详细的解释:面向对象编程:它模拟现实世界中的事物和事物间的交互。面向对象的编程是以对象为核心,通过对对象的属性和行为进行定义和操作,实现对问题的求解。比如...

面向对象和面向过程的区别
面向对象和面向过程的区别:面向对象是一种编程思想,它主要关注现实世界中的实体和概念,通过抽象的方式将现实世界中的事物转换为程序中的对象。面向对象编程强调的是对象的属性、行为以及对象之间的关系。这种编程范式更注重事物的属性与行为,以及如何通过这些属性和行为来操作事物,以达到特定的目的。对象...

面向对象的编程与面向过程的有什么区别?
面向过程就是分析出解决问题所需要的步骤,然后用函数把这些步骤一步一步实现,使用的时候一个一个依次调用就可以了。面向对象是把构成问题事务分解成各个对象,建立对象的目的不是为了完成一个步骤,而是为了描叙某个事物在整个解决问题的步骤中的行为。

面向过程与面向对象的区别
面向过程与面向对象的区别问题回答如下:首段:面向过程和面向对象是两种不同的编程思想和设计理念。面向过程是一种以步骤和操作为中心的编程方式,而面向对象则更注重于对现实世界中事物的抽象和模拟。接下来,我们将详细描述这两种编程范式的区别及其应用场景。1.面向过程编程:过程为中心:面向过程编程以...

水芳13859712282问: 编程中,面向对象和面向过程是什么意思?
西山区山姆回答: 面向对象是以事物(对象)为中心进行编程,面向过程是以事件为中心进行编程. 举一个例子:一架飞机起飞.如果以面向过程来看,那么有以下的事件:飞机启动发动机,飞机在地面加速,飞机离开地面,飞机升高,飞机收起起落架.如果以面向对象来看,那么关心的是飞机本身而不是它如果起飞.需要抽象出一个飞机的“类”,类中有飞机的“属性”比如发动机,机翼,起落架等,这个类可以有某些方法,比如发动机启动,起落架的收放等.也就是说面向对象时,我们以飞机本身来考察,而不是以飞机起飞所发生的阶段性事件来考察.

水芳13859712282问: 面向过程和面向对象程序开发的区别 -
西山区山姆回答: 本质都是为了解决问题. 相对来说,面向过程会关注解决问题的一系列步骤.面向对象就显得方便些,只需要调用某个类或者接口的方法即可. 当然,这个类或者接口最终要解决这个问题,还是会实现“面向过程”的功能的,区别在于思维方式不同. 最终都面向过程和面向对象程序开发的区别

水芳13859712282问: 面向对象编程相对于面向过程编程有什么优点?二者有什么区别? -
西山区山姆回答: 面向过程就是分析出解决问题所需要的步骤,然后用函数把这些步骤一步一步实现,使用的时候一个一个依次调用就可以了. 面向对象是把构成问题事务分解成各个对象,建立对象的目的不是为了完成一个步骤,而是为了描叙某个事物在整个解...

水芳13859712282问: 编程中的面向对象和面向过程,都是什么意思啊? -
西山区山姆回答: 面向对象,就是界面信息显示对用户的互动体验,面相过程就是数据从后台到展示的程序数据交互处理

水芳13859712282问: 面向对象编程和面向过程编程有什么区别???
西山区山姆回答: 简单的说,“面向过程”是一种以事件为中心的编程思想,而“面向对象”是一种以事物为中心的编程思想. 比如“面向过程”就是汽车启动是一个事件,汽车到站是另一个事件.在编程序的时候我们关心的是某一个事件,而不是汽车本身,我们分别对启动和到站编写程序;而“面向对象”需要建立一个汽车的实体,由实体引发事件.我们关心的是一个汽车而不是汽车的某个事件.

水芳13859712282问: 面向对象的编程和面向过程的编程有什么区别? -
西山区山姆回答: C语言是面向过程的编程,它的最重要特点是函数,通过主函数来调用一个个子函数.程序运行的顺序都是程序员决定好了的.它是我学的第一种程序语言.C++是面向对象的编程,类是它的主要特点,程序执行过程中,先由主函数进入,定义...

水芳13859712282问: 面向过程的编程和面向对象的编程有什么区别? -
西山区山姆回答: 面向对象 一、面向过程与面向对象的区别: 前者是一种谓语和宾语的关系;后者是一种主语和谓语的关系 . 二、面向对象的三个特征: ??封装 ??继承 ??多态 三、类与对象: 对象又称作实例,是实际存在的该类事物的每个个体.类是对...

水芳13859712282问: 面向过程和面向对象编程语言的区别 -
西山区山姆回答: C语言是面向过程的编程,它的最重要特点是函数,通过主函数来调用一个个子函数.

水芳13859712282问: 小白提问,C语言中面向过程和面向对象是什么意思,谁能简单的帮我解释清楚 -
西山区山姆回答: 面向对象和面向过程是两种不同的编程思维模式或者说是编程方法,而C语言本身是纯面向过程的语言,如果你不了解类和对象,那你最好还是不要问什么是面向对象,因为说了你也理解不了,等你学完了java,你自然就知道什么叫面向对象编程了

水芳13859712282问: 编程中到底什么是“面向对象”和“面向过程”啊?
西山区山姆回答: 举个例子 面向过程好像是 你 要去某个地方你知道告诉他怎么走 做什么车 在哪下车 在哪换车而面向对象就是 你只要告诉我要到哪里 就行了 万物皆对象 类就是一个抽象的 东西而对象就是具体的实例了 或者说 类是 一个模具 而对象就是 这个模具生产出来的 产品 我也是学这个的 有时间可以多交流qq32092823


本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网